Career path
| Career Role | Description |
|---|---|
| Educational Psychologist | Assess and support children with learning difficulties; design and implement educational interventions. High demand in UK schools and specialist settings. |
| Learning & Development Specialist | Develop and deliver training programs for employees; improve employee performance and engagement. Growing need in corporate and educational sectors. |
| Instructional Designer | Create engaging and effective learning materials using educational psychology principles. Strong demand across industries, especially in e-learning. |
| Special Educational Needs Coordinator (SENCO) | Oversee the provision of support for children with special educational needs within a school. Essential role in UK education; increasing demand due to rising SEN numbers. |
| Child Psychologist | Work with children and families to address emotional, behavioral, and developmental concerns. Significant demand in mental health services and private practice. |
